Guardrail and Walkway Installation

The final solution included the installation of:

  • Top Fix guardrail systems to provide permanent collective edge protection around the roof perimeter.
  • Kee Walk systems to establish safe and clearly defined access routes across the roof.

The Top Fix system was chosen for its strength and reliability, offering long-term fall protection in a permanent installation. The Kee Walk system complemented this by allowing maintenance personnel to move safely between access points without risk.
